HC Deb 29 October 1953 vol 518 c398W
Mr. Lucas

asked the Minister of Transport and Civil Aviation whether he is aware of the increased volume of through traffic now using the Chiswick High Road; what plans he has for the development of Ellesmere Road, W.4, to link up with the Cromwell Road extension and the Great West Road; when he anticipates work will be restarted on this project; and whether, in view of the importance of hastening road traffic from London Airport to Central London, he will make a statement.

Mr. Lennox-Boyd

I know of the increased traffic in Chiswick High Road and, in view also of the increasing use of London Airport. I realise the importance of completing as soon as possible the alternative route from West Cromwell Road to the Great West Road, of which the Ellesmere Road section was an instalment. This work would cost about £4½ million and I cannot at present forecast when funds will be available to enable it to proceed.
